Integrating GenAI into software engineering offers several advantages, including optimized costs, enhanced security and compliance, market differentiation through innovation, talent retention, and scalability. However, it is crucial to use GenAI as a supplement to human capabilities, as human developers possess the historical knowledge and experience necessary to interpret complex business objectives. By strategically leveraging GenAI while centering the human element, organizations can enhance productivity, improve product quality, and ensure alignment with strategic goals, positioning themselves for long-term success.
Key takeaways:
```html
- Generative AI (GenAI) is revolutionizing software product engineering by enhancing development processes, driving digital transformation, and accelerating innovation.
- GenAI can optimize costs, enhance security and compliance, foster market differentiation through innovation, and improve talent retention and attraction.
- GenAI supports better alignment between tech and business goals by assisting across the development life cycle, improving productivity, and compressing the development process.
- While GenAI is a powerful tool, it should supplement human capabilities, ensuring that software development aligns with organizational experiences and business objectives.